33333071 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 33333072. Its totient is φ = 33333070.

The previous prime is 33333067. The next prime is 33333077. The reversal of 33333071 is 17033333.

It is a weak prime.

It is an emirp because it is prime and its reverse (17033333) is a distict pr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 33333071 - 22 = 33333067 is a prime.

It is a super-2 number, since 2×333330712 = 2222187244582082, which contains 22 as substring.

It is a Chen prime.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(33333077)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 16666535 + 16666536.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(16666536).

Almost surely, 233333071 is an apocalyptic number.

33333071 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

33333071 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

33333071 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1701, while the sum is 23.

The square root of 33333071 is about 5773.4799731185. The cubic root of 33333071 is about 321.8289505995.

The spelling of 33333071 in words is "thirty-three million, three hundred thirty-three thousand, seventy-one".
